Myrs ago (Horiuchi
et al
., 1993). This pseudogene contains three inactivating
mutations: an 8 bp deletion in exon 3, the insertion of a T in exon 7 and a non-
sense mutation in exon 8 (Kawaguchi
et al
., 1992). The 8 bp deletion is present in
both humans and chimpanzees whereas the other two mutations are human-spe-
cific (Kawaguchi
et al
., 1992) consistent with the 8 bp deletion being the original
inactivating mutation in the human-chimpanzee lineage. In gorilla and orang-
utan, the extra
Cyp21
gene copies are inactivated by various other mutations
(Kawaguchi
et al., 1992).
